With the European summer transfer window rapidly closing, Paris Saint-Germain have initiated formal contact with Ajax Amsterdam to secure Belgian winger Mika Godts in a blockbuster deal estimated at €40 million. Sources close to the negotiations in Paris indicate that Sporting Director Luis Campos has identified the 21-year-old forward as a priority target to complete manager Luis Enrique’s attacking puzzle before the August 31 deadline. The French giants are aiming to capitalize on Ajax's current financial restructuring by testing the Dutch club's resolve with an opening package of €35 million plus performance-related add-ons.

The Catalyst: Why the Mika Godts PSG Link is Surging Before the Deadline

Observing the current market trend, top-tier European clubs are shifting away from over-inflated veteran contracts in favor of elite, high-upside developmental talents. Reports from the field indicate that PSG’s scouting department has tracked Godts’ progress at the Johan Cruyff Arena for over eighteen months, noting his rapid development under the pressure of Eredivisie and Europa League fixtures.

The sudden urgency stems from an unexpected injury setback in the PSG forward line, which has forced Luis Enrique to demand immediate reinforcement on the left flank. With the reigning Ligue 1 champions aiming for deep runs in both domestic competitions and the newly formatted UEFA Champions League, securing a natural dribbler who can operate in tight spaces has become paramount.

Insiders close to the Dutch club reveal that Ajax manager Francesco Farioli has held private discussions with the player to convince him to stay for one more developmental season. However, the allure of playing in the UEFA Champions League alongside world-class talents in Paris has reportedly made the Belgian youth international eager for the move.

Expert Tactical Analysis: How Mika Godts Fits into Luis Enrique's System

Evaluating the tactical implications, Godts offers a profile that directly complements the explosive speed of Bradley Barcola and Ousmane Dembélé. Our deep dive into his performance metrics reveals that the Belgian youth international ranks in the upper 95th percentile for progressive carries and successful take-ons per 90 minutes in European competition.

Under Luis Enrique, PSG has evolved into a possession-heavy side that relies heavily on wingers who can isolate defenders in 1v1 situations and cut inside to create shooting angles. Godts’ ambipedal nature and exceptional low center of gravity make him a nightmare to defend against, particularly against low-block defenses that PSG routinely encounters in Ligue 1.

Comparisons are already being drawn between Godts and former Ligue 1 standouts due to his explosive acceleration. Unlike traditional wingers who hug the touchline, Godts prefers to occupy the half-spaces, a tactical flexibility that Luis Enrique highly prizes. His integration would also alleviate the creative burden on midfield orchestrators like Vitinha and Warren Zaïre-Emery.

The Road Ahead: Financial Fair Play and the Final Hurdle

The ultimate success of the Mika Godts PSG transfer rests on complex financial structures and UEFA's Financial Fair Play (FFP) parameters. PSG’s hierarchy must ensure this acquisition fits within their current wage bill, especially after substantial outlays in previous windows.

Ajax is expected to hold out for a hefty sell-on clause, a standard negotiating tactic for their prized academy graduates and developmental successes. If Luis Campos can negotiate a structure that satisfies the Ajax board while staying within FFP limits, the transfer could be finalized within the next 48 to 72 hours.

Should the deal collapse, PSG has reportedly prepared a shortlist of alternative targets, but Godts remains the undisputed priority for the coaching staff. The next few days will determine whether the Belgian starlet takes the leap to the French capital or remains the focal point of Ajax’s rebuild in Amsterdam.
